Özet
Galimcan Gıylmanov, günümüz Kazan Tatar edebiyatının önde gelen isimlerinden biridir. Kırsal kesimde yetişen ve Tatar halkının gelenek ve göreneklerini tüm varlığıyla taşıyan bu sanatçı, eserlerinin çoğunda sıradan insanların hayat felsefesini konu edinmiş ve postmodernizmin etkisiyle büyülü gerçekçiliği birleştirmiştir. Gerçek hayatın içinden aldığı hadiselerle kaleme döktüğü bu eserinde kahramanları ustalıkla betimlemiş, Tatar halkının zengin söz varlığından da ustaca yararlanmıştır. Yazar, eserinde hayatın anlamı üzerine düşüncelerini felsefi bir dille sunmuş, vatanına olan sevgisini Tatar halkının maddi ve manevi inançlarıyla harmanlamış ve kültürel zenginliğini mitolojik ögelerle birleştirmiştir. Tatar halkının kültürel zenginliğini ise mitolojik ögelerle birleştirmiştir. Bu bağlamda, Oça Torgan K?ş?ler (Uçan İnsanlar) adlı romanında Tatar köylerini, şehir hayatını, vatan sevgisini, baba ocağının önemini, ahlâkı, aşkı ve namus kavramlarını derinlemesine ele alarak tasvir etmiştir. Yazar, bu romanında, köyünü on sekiz yıl önce terk eden Sevben isimli delikanlının başından geçen olayları ve üç farklı Sevben tipiyle karşılaşılan durumu ele almıştır. Sevben'in geride bıraktığı annesi ve sevgilisi Seviye'nin yaşadığı psikolojik buhran en ince ayrıntısına kadar anlatılmıştır. Çalışmada, eserden yola çıkarak Galimcan Gıylmanov'un ustalıkla kaleme aldığı kahramanlar ve mitolojik ögeler derinlemesine incelenmiştir. Galimcan Gıylmanov is one of the leading names in today's Kazan Tatar literature. This artist, who grew up in the countryside and carries the traditions and customs of the Tatar people with all his being, has mostly dealt with the philosophy of life of ordinary people in most of his works and combined his works with magical realism under the name of postmodernism. In this work, which he wrote with events from real life, he skillfully described the heroes and skillfully used the rich vocabulary of the Tatar people. In his work, the author presented his thoughts on the meaning of life in a philosophical language; he kneaded his love for his homeland with the material and spiritual beliefs of the Tatar people; and combined the cultural richness of the Tatar people with mythological elements. In this context, in his novel called Flying People, he depicted Tatar villages, city life, love for the homeland, the importance of the fatherland, morality and love, and the concept of honor by blending them with eternal values. In this novel of the author, the events experienced by a young man named Sevben who left his village eighteen years ago and the psychological crisis experienced by his mother and his lover Level, whom he left behind, are narrated. In the study, the heroes and mythological elements that Galimcan Gıylmanov masterfully wrote were examined based on the work. Keywords: Kazan Tatar Literature, Galimcan Gıylmanov, Prose, Mythology.
